Cirrus Logic 546x video driver for Microsoft Windows NT 4.0 version 1.71b This package contains an update to the device driver for the Cirrus Logic 546x video adapter that comes preinstalled in your IBM(R) computer. This update requires approximately 1.5 MB of space on your hard disk (drive C). This update package is intended for IBM PC 300GL machine types 6561-xxx and 6591-xxx that come preinstalled with a Cirrus Logic 546x video adapter. Print this file so that you can refer to it during the installation. Downloading the update ---------------------- 1. Click the file link named Qb8t15a.exe to download the file from the Web page. 2. When prompted, select a drive and directory in which to save the downloaded file. Installing the update ---------------------- 1. Click Start, highlight Find, then click Files and folders. 2. Type qb8t15a.exe in the search box, then click Find Now. This will locate the qb8t15a.exe file you just downloaded. 3. Double-click the icon for qb8t15a.exe. 4. When prompted for a drive letter compatible with a 1.44M 3.5" disk, type A and press Enter. A license agreement will appear. 5. To read the license agreement, press Enter to move from page to page. When you reach the end of the license agreement, you will hear three beeps. 6. If you agree with the license agreement, press Y and Enter. If you do not agree, press CTRL+C to exit the installation. 7. Put a blank 1.44M 3.5" floppy disk in drive A and press Enter. The installation disk will be created. 8. Once the extraction is complete and you are prompted to press Y to do another copy, press Enter to exit the program. 9. Click Start, then select Settings, then click Control Panel. This will open the Control Panel main window. 10. Double-click Display, then click Settings, then click Display Type, then click Change. 11. Click Have Disk, then when asked where to copy manufacturer's files from, type in A:\ and then click OK. 12. Click on Cirrus Logic 546x 1.71b, then click OK. 13. When the Third-Party Drivers window appears click Yes. A message stating that the drivers were successfully installed will be displayed. 14. Close the Display Type and Display Properties windows. 15. When asked to reboot your machine, remove the floppy disk from the drive, then click Yes. 16. Log into Windows NT as usual. 17. When the Invalid Display Settings window appears click OK. 18. Select the desired Desktop Area, Color Palette and Refresh Frequency. 19. Click the Test button. When the Testing Mode window appears, click OK. A display pattern will appear to test the selected settings. 20. If the test bitmap was displayed correctly, click OK. Otherwise, click Cancel then repeat steps 18 and 19. 21. Click Apply, then click OK to save the settings. Note: If you experience difficulties with adjusting your display settings, you may need to reapply the Windows NT Service Pack you currently have installed on your machine.
